Chicken Caesar Wrap

Ingredients

Scale
  • 2 burrito wraps
  • 1 chicken breast (boneless, skinless)
  • kosher salt and ground black pepper
  • 2 cups romaine lettuce, chopped
  • 1/4 cup Caesar dressing (we love this homemade version)
  • 1/4 cup parmesan cheese, shredded

Instructions

Grilled Chicken Breasts:

  1. Combine salt and pepper in small bowl.
  2. Place chicken breasts on plate and sprinkle both sides with a generous amount of the salt and pepper mix.
  3. Heat grill to medium heat (approximately 400 degrees).
  4. Place chicken on direct heat (direct flame) and cook at medium heat for 4-5 minutes per side.
  5. Move chicken away from the direct heat (direct flame) so that it is cooking on indirect heat (maintaining the same grill temp) and cook for an additional 5-7 minutes (you don’t need to flip during this point because the chicken will cook as if it is in an oven) or until the internal temperature of the thickest part of the chicken reads 160 degrees F. on your meat thermometer.
  6. Remove from grill and let rest at least 5 minutes (the chicken will continue to cook during this time and the internal temp will continue to rise up to 10 additional degrees). Chicken is safe to eat when it reaches an internal temp of 165 degrees F.
  7. Cut into bite-sized cubes. 

Chicken Caesar Wrap:

  1. Place lettuce, parmesan cheese and caesar dressing in the middle of your burrito tortilla. 
  2. Add chicken on top.
  3. Fold the outsides in then take the flap of burrito closest to you and fold over the middle.
  4. Continue rolling until fully wrapped.
  5. Cut in half and enjoy!
